# Rust Kernel
|
|
|
|
A modern, experimental x86_64 kernel written in Rust with advanced monitoring, diagnostics, and stress testing capabilities.
|
|
|
|
## Features
|
|
|
|
### Core Systems
|
|
- **Memory Management**: Page allocation, kmalloc/vmalloc, physical/virtual memory mapping
|
|
- **Process Management**: Basic process structures, kernel threads, scheduling framework
|
|
- **File System**: In-memory file system (memfs) with shell integration
|
|
- **Device Drivers**: PS/2 keyboard, serial console, basic device framework
|
|
- **Network Stack**: Basic networking with loopback interface and statistics
|
|
- **Module System**: Dynamic module loading with dependency management
|
|
- **System Calls**: Basic syscall infrastructure and user mode support
|
|
|
|
### Advanced Features
|
|
- **System Diagnostics**: Real-time health monitoring with categorized diagnostics
|
|
- **Performance Monitoring**: Comprehensive performance counters and analysis
|
|
- **Stress Testing**: Memory, CPU, and filesystem stress testing with metrics
|
|
- **Advanced Logging**: Multi-level logging with filtering and statistics
|
|
- **System Information**: Detailed hardware detection and system reporting
|
|
- **Interactive Shell**: 20+ commands for system administration and testing
|
|
|
|
### Architecture Support
|
|
- **x86_64**: Complete support with GDT, IDT, paging, and exception handling
|
|
- **Boot Process**: Multiboot-compatible with staged initialization
|
|
- **Hardware Detection**: CPUID-based CPU information and feature detection
|
|
|

## Shell Commands
|
|
|
|
The kernel includes an interactive shell with comprehensive system administration commands:
|
|
|
|
### System Information
|
|
- `info` - Basic system information
|
|
- `sysinfo [show|compact|benchmark]` - Detailed system information
|
|
- `mem` - Memory statistics
|
|
- `uptime` - System uptime
|
|
|
|
### Diagnostics and Health
|
|
- `diag [report|check|clear|critical]` - System diagnostics
|
|
- `health [status|check|monitor]` - Health monitoring
|
|
- `stress <type> [duration]` - Stress testing (memory, cpu, filesystem, all)
|
|
|
|
### Performance Monitoring
|
|
- `perf [report|clear|counters|reset]` - Performance monitoring
|
|
- `bench [list|run|all|stress]` - Built-in benchmarks
|
|
- `log [show|clear|level|stats]` - Advanced logging
|
|
|
|
### File System
|
|
- `ls [path]` - List directory contents
|
|
- `cat <file>` - Display file contents
|
|
- `mkdir <path>` - Create directory
|
|
- `touch <file>` - Create file
|
|
- `rm <path>` - Remove file/directory
|
|
|
|
### Development
|
|
- `test [all|memory|fs|module]` - Run kernel tests
|
|
- `mod [list|test|unload]` - Module management
|
|
- `exec <program>` - Execute user programs
|
|
- `clear` - Clear screen
|
|
- `help` - Show all commands
|
|
